Highly parallel processing to power your breakthrough innovations.
Delivers over a teraFLOPS (floating-point operations per second) of double-precision peak performance. Additionally as compared with Intel® Xeon® processor E5 family-based servers the Intel® Xeon Phi™ coprocessor delivers up to 2.3 times higher peak FLOPS and up to 3 times more performance per watt and up to 7 times better performance on certain financial services applications.
Applications can support both Intel® Xeon® processors and Intel® Xeon Phi™ coprocessors which use common languages models and familiar and standard development tools so there’s no need to learn new languages or tools.
Leverage the compute flexibility of Intel® Xeon Phi™ coprocessors to either use in Intel® Xeon® processors to accelerate processing of highly parallel code or create independent high-performance computing compute nodes with its own IP address and can run applications independently—unlike a basic accelerator.
Optimized for memory bandwidth bound workloads (STREAM Energy) memory capacity workloads (DCC Energy) or both (Reverse Time Migration).
